Use of our webshop
When you visit our webshop, various data is collected from you. These are not names, email addresses and phone numbers, but the more technical data. Think of your IP Address (anonymized!), cookies and your browser data such as your type of browser Chrome, Internet Explorer or FireFox.

Your IP Address and browser data are examples that we use in Google Analytics. This software allows us to see how visitors like you use our web store. We have entered into a processing agreement with Google to agree on how to handle our data. Furthermore, we allow Google to see the obtained Analytics information when we ask them for support. And if we have received your permission, Google Analytics temporarily links the data as described above to your Google Account so that you will see personalized ads through remarketing.

So when you visit and use our web store, we obtain certain data from you. And that may be personal data. We store and use only the personal data that is provided directly by you, in the context of the service you have requested, or of which it is clear at the time of submission that it is provided to us for processing.

Placing an order (without or with an account)

When you place an order with us, we need several pieces of information from you. These are:

Email address
Name
Last name
Delivery and billing address
Phone number
Payment details
IP-Address

These details are needed to receive payment and ensure that your order reaches your home. The e-mail address is requested so that we can send you a confirmation with a summary of your order, as well as the invoice. The phone number is mainly used to inform you, if necessary, about changes concerning your order. The IP-Address is used to exclude fraudsters from visiting our webshop.

If you order from us with an account (you can also create one while ordering), then we keep the data as long as you want to keep your account. After all, the reason you have created an account is probably because you do not want to fill in all the information over and over again.

Getting in touch

If you have questions, complaints or feedback, you can call, email and chat with us. To help you with this as quickly and effectively as possible, we use various pieces of information from you. Initially, only your name, e-mail address and/or phone number. But if you have ordered from us before, we can also see your order history. This is linked to your e-mail address. Saves you having to find an order number again!

Apart from the above information, you are free to choose which information you share with us. The information you send us will be kept as long as necessary according to the nature of the form or the content of your e-mail for a complete response and handling.
